MLB: San Diego 4, Pittsburgh 3 (11 inn.)

SAN DIEGO, April 25 (UPI) -- Brian Giles drove in Chris Burke from second base with two out in the 11th inning Friday, giving the San Diego Padres a 4-3 victory over Pittsburgh.

The Padres snapped a three-game losing streak and Pittsburgh lost for the first time in four games.

The contest had been tied since the sixth, when Pittsburgh's Andy LaRoche drove in Eric Hinske from third with a single. San Diego put the potential winning run on second with one away in the 10th, but Sean Burnett escaped the jam.

Matt Capps (0-1) was not so fortunate in the 11th. After Luis Rodriguez flew out to start the inning, Burke drew a five-pitch walk. Jody Gerut then popped out to third, but Burke stole second, after which David Eckstein walked.

Giles, facing a 1-2 count after fouling off two pitches, drove a ball to deep right that was ruled a single, easily bringing in Burke from second.

That left Edwin Moreno (1-2) as the winning pitcher. He allowed a hit while working both the 10th and 11th innings.
